180 gr. Swift Scirocco or 200 gr Nosler Accubond. Not the best b.c. but they won't fall apart. Norma has a 180 gr bonded bullet that they are claiming a bc of .615 but only available in factory ammo I believe. -

About any rifle will do so long as you can shoot it well out to 3 to 400 yds. Glass quality is more important than power. 14 power will be plenty and a Leopold VX-3 would be a very minimum as far as quality. Coues will vanish into almost nothing, especially with bad optics.
